For more 23 * information on the Apache Software Foundation, please see 24 * <http://www.apache.org/>. 25 * 26 */ 27 package org.apache.hc.core5.http.io; 28 29 import java.io.IOException; 30 31 import org.apache.hc.core5.annotation.Contract; 32 import org.apache.hc.core5.annotation.ThreadingBehavior; 33 import org.apache.hc.core5.http.ClassicHttpRequest; 34 import org.apache.hc.core5.http.ClassicHttpResponse; 35 import org.apache.hc.core5.http.HttpException; 36 import org.apache.hc.core5.http.protocol.HttpContext; 37 38 /** 39 * HttpServerRequestHandler represents a routine for processing of a specific group 40 * of HTTP requests. Request execution filters are designed to take care of protocol 41 * specific aspects, whereas individual request handlers are expected to take 42 * care of application specific HTTP processing. The main purpose of a request 43 * handler is to generate a response object with a content entity to be sent 44 * back to the client in response to the given request. 45 * 46 * @since 5.0 47 */ 48 @Contract(threading = ThreadingBehavior.STATELESS) 49 public interface HttpServerRequestHandler { 50 51 /** 52 * Response trigger that can be used to submit a final HTTP response 53 * and terminate HTTP request processing. 54 */ 55 interface ResponseTrigger { 56 57 /** 58 * Sends an intermediate informational HTTP response to the client. 59 * 60 * @param response the intermediate (1xx) HTTP response 61 */ 62 void sendInformation(ClassicHttpResponse response) throws HttpException, IOException; 63 64 /** 65 * Sends a final HTTP response to the client. 66 * 67 * @param response the final (non 1xx) HTTP response 68 */ 69 void submitResponse(ClassicHttpResponse response) throws HttpException, IOException; 70 71 } 72 73 /** 74 * Handles the request and submits a final response to be sent back to the client. 75 * 76 * @param request the actual request. 77 * @param responseTrigger the response trigger. 78 * @param context the actual execution context. 79 */ 80 void handle( 81 ClassicHttpRequest request, 82 ResponseTrigger responseTrigger, 83 HttpContext context) throws HttpException, IOException; 84 85 }
